What affects the price

Replacing your roof involves several variables that shift your final bill. The total square footage of your property is the biggest factor, followed closely by the pitch or steepness of your roof, which dictates how safely crews can work. You will also need to choose your materials—architectural shingles, metal, or tile each carry different price points. We also have to account for the removal and disposal of your current roof, plus the condition of the underlying wood decking that might need repairs once the old shingles are off. What does a roofing nailer do for a steel roof installation?

A roofing nailer is a tool used for driving nails into roofing materials. For steel roofs, it's not the primary fastening method. Instead, specialized screws with rubber washers are used to secure metal panels. The nailer is more common for asphalt shingles. How does a standing seam roof work on a Detroit house?

A standing seam roof features vertical panels with raised seams that interlock. This design creates a watertight seal, making it highly resistant to leaks. The raised seams also allow for expansion and contraction of the metal with temperature changes. This system is excellent for shedding snow and ice common in Detroit winters.
